From 3596523a4380fb88549c56023a0faef0c6c36750 Mon Sep 17 00:00:00 2001 From: Stephan Linz Date: Sat, 27 Jul 2024 19:02:23 +0200 Subject: [PATCH] snippets: tests: all drivers: i2c: add SC18IS604 Support the SC18IS604 chip on build all I2C driver test. Signed-off-by: Stephan Linz --- .../tstdrv-bldall-i2c-adj.conf | 7 +++++++ .../tstdrv-bldall-i2c-adj.overlay | 19 ++++++++++++++++++- 2 files changed, 25 insertions(+), 1 deletion(-) diff --git a/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.conf b/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.conf index e9ca22677a..6c678ce6b9 100644 --- a/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.conf +++ b/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.conf @@ -1,2 +1,9 @@ # Copyright (c) 2024 TiaC Systems # SPDX-License-Identifier: Apache-2.0 + +CONFIG_MFD=y +CONFIG_I2C=y +CONFIG_SPI=y +CONFIG_GPIO=y + +CONFIG_DYNAMIC_THREAD_POOL_SIZE=2 diff --git a/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.overlay b/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.overlay index deff50c02c..aafa041233 100644 --- a/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.overlay +++ b/snippets/tstdrv-bldall-i2c-adj/tstdrv-bldall-i2c-adj.overlay @@ -44,7 +44,24 @@ clock-frequency = <2000000>; /* one entry for every devices */ - /* cs-gpios = <&test_gpio_adj 0 0>; */ + cs-gpios = <&test_gpio_adj 0 0>; + + test_spi_sc18is604: sc18is604-spi@0 { + compatible = "nxp,sc18is604"; + status = "okay"; + reg = <0x0>; + spi-max-frequency = <650000>; + reset-gpios = <&test_gpio_adj 0 0>; + interrupt-gpios = <&test_gpio_adj 0 0>; + + test_spi_sc18is604_i2c: sc18is604-spi-i2c { + compatible = "nxp,sc18is604-i2c"; + status = "okay"; + #address-cells = <1>; + #size-cells = <0>; + clock-frequency = <100000>; + }; + }; }; test_uart_adj: uart@ddddeeee {